(06 LC)How can making new friends and trying new activities improve your health?
ValentinkaMS [17]

Answer:

New friends can introduce you to more new friends and help you make connections.

Explanation:

Human beings are<em> social creatures</em> and they need to connect with others in order to develop personality and share positive emotional experiences. Building social connections can be difficult at any age because it is a complicated process. Meanwhile, communicating and developing relationships with new friends will help you to learn more about yourself and develop emotional intelligence (EI).

High <u>emotional intelligence (EI)</u> will help you to connect with others better and understand when it is a good time to raise certain topics and when you should wait. It will also help you to manage negative emotions and situations in a healthy way.
